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of inspection tools, and in particular to a scale for measuring the diameter of a frustum. Background Technology

[0002] Before a product leaves the factory, its dimensions, precision, and other parameters must be inspected. Only products that pass the inspection can be shipped. For certain frustum-shaped parts, the diameter of its outer wall at different heights is one of the important parameters that needs to be inspected. Therefore, it must be inspected before the part can leave the factory. Traditionally, when inspecting the diameter of the outer wall of frustum-shaped parts, a measuring ruler is used. This measuring ruler is supported on the top surface of the frustum by a support structure. After the measuring structures on both sides are adjusted to the same height, the inspection can be carried out.

[0003] However, traditional measuring rulers have certain problems in use. Their support structures are mostly designed for solid frustum parts. They are not suitable for hollow frustum parts (with a ring-shaped cross-section). In addition, the support structure needs to ensure multi-point support to ensure that the support surface is coplanar with the top surface of the frustum. However, the traditional support structure is relatively simple, consisting of only a few legs. Often, after support, there is an angle between the ruler rod and the support surface, which affects the accuracy of the test results.

[0004] At the same time, when it is necessary to adjust the relative position of the detection structure, the relatively complex detection structure makes the operation time-consuming and laborious, which seriously affects the operation efficiency.

[0017] Compared with the prior art, this utility model has the following advantages:

[0018] This type of frustum diameter measuring ruler features a simple structure, ingenious design, and rational layout. It addresses the problems inherent in traditional frustum-shaped part measuring rulers during operation by incorporating a unique structure. Firstly, it uses carbon fiber for the ruler rod and measuring scale, significantly reducing overall weight while maintaining sufficient rigidity and strength, making operation more convenient. Secondly, its support mechanism employs an adaptive support structure design, ensuring that during each measurement, three points in a single support mechanism are simultaneously in contact with the support surface, thus achieving stable support and ensuring accurate measurement results. Simultaneously, its adjustment mechanism utilizes a positioning structure with an eccentric shaft, enabling quick and convenient locking or unlocking, effectively improving work efficiency. Furthermore, this frustum diameter measuring ruler has a simple manufacturing process and low production cost. [0036] The working process of the frustum diameter measuring ruler of this utility model embodiment is as follows: When it is necessary to measure the outer wall diameter of the frustum workpiece 31, firstly, take a standard workpiece (a product with qualified dimensions) to calibrate the measuring ruler. During calibration, place the ruler body as a whole on the top surface of the workpiece 31, ensuring that the support mechanisms at both ends are in contact with the top surface of the workpiece 31 at the same time. Then, select a suitable length of equal height calibration block 30 according to the height difference between the position to be measured and the top surface of the workpiece 31, and adjust the relative position of the measuring ruler 22 relative to the ruler rod 1 (vertical direction) to ensure that the probes of the fixed measuring axis 26 and the dial indicator 27 are coaxial. Then, adjust the relative position of the adjustment mechanism on the ruler rod 1 (horizontal direction) to ensure that the probes of the fixed measuring axis 26 and the dial indicator 27 can both contact the outer wall of the workpiece 31. Finally, zero the dial indicator 27, and the calibration is completed.

[0037] When it is necessary to inspect the workpiece 31, simply place this measuring ruler on the workpiece 31, ensuring that the support mechanism can contact the top surface of the workpiece 31, and fix the measuring shaft 26 and the probe of the dial indicator 27 to contact the outer wall of the workpiece 31 at the same time. Then observe the reading on the dial indicator 27. If the reading exceeds the allowable error range, it means that the workpiece 31 is a defective product. Conversely, if the reading does not exceed the allowable error range, it means that the workpiece 31 is a qualified product.

[0038] In order to improve the overall strength and rigidity of the ruler, this measuring ruler is composed of two parallel ruler rods 1. The middle of these two rods 1 are fixedly connected by a central connecting mechanism. When connecting, it is only necessary to drive the first bolt to rotate in the first upper clamping block 2, and the first lower clamping block 3, which is threaded to it, will move upward along its axis, that is, the first lower clamping block 3 moves towards the first upper clamping block 2, thereby achieving the purpose of clamping the two ruler rods 1 at the same time.

[0039] The second upper clamping block 4 and the second lower clamping block 5 in the support mechanism are also fixedly connected to the two ruler rods 1 in the same way. When the support mechanism contacts the top surface of the workpiece 31, the third bolt 8 is driven to rotate by a screwdriver. Since the third bolt 8 is threadedly connected to the support block 7, the third bolt 8 will also move linearly relative to the support block 7 while rotating, driving the third bolt 8 to move downward relative to the support block 7. The bottom end of the third bolt 8 directly contacts the top surface of the workpiece 31. Under the action of the third bolt 8, there is a certain gap between the support block 7 and the workpiece 31, and the two support columns 10 will remain extended under the action of the spring 11 above them. That is to say, as long as the gap between the support block 7 and the workpiece 31 does not exceed the maximum stroke of the support column 10, the two support columns 10 will always be in contact with the top surface of the workpiece 31. This structure can ensure that there are three support points in each support mechanism that are in contact with the workpiece 31. After the third bolt 8 is properly adjusted, the two locking screws 13 are tightened respectively to lock and position the two support columns 10. At this time, the workpiece 31 forms a stable support for the support mechanism.

[0040] When the adjustment mechanism needs to be driven to move along the length of the ruler 1 (horizontal movement), the two upper and lower clamping drive shafts 18 on the adjustment mechanism are turned on respectively. Since the first eccentric section 19 on the upper and lower clamping drive shaft 18 is rotatably connected to the round hole at the bottom of the upper and lower clamping block connector 17, it will pull the upper and lower clamping block connector 17 to move. The top of the upper and lower clamping block connector 17 is fixedly connected to the third upper clamping block 14 through the first clamping block fixing shaft 16. Therefore, the above action will eventually drive the third upper clamping block 14 to move up or down relative to the third lower clamping block 15. That is to say, the two upper and lower clamping drive shafts 18 can control the distance between the third upper clamping block 14 and the third lower clamping block 15 (non-clamping state) and the proximity (clamping state). When the two are in the non-clamping state, the adjustment mechanism can reciprocate along the length of the ruler 1, thereby adjusting the relative position between the fixed measuring shaft 26 or dial indicator 27 connected to the bottom of the adjustment mechanism and the workpiece 31. After the adjustment is completed, the upper and lower clamping drive shafts 18 are rotated in the opposite direction to fix the adjustment mechanism back to the ruler 1.

[0041] When it is necessary to adjust the relative position of the measuring scale 22 in the longitudinal direction (i.e., when adjusting the fixed measuring shaft 26 or dial indicator 27 located at the bottom of the measuring scale 22), this is also achieved by rotating the clamping drive shaft 24. When the clamping drive shaft 24 rotates, the second eccentric section 25 on it drives the movable clamping block 23 to move horizontally. When the side of the movable clamping block 23 contacts the side wall of the measuring scale 22, the measuring scale 22 is clamped and fixed by the movable clamping block 23 and the inner wall of the sleeve 20 (or the fixed clamping block set on the inner wall of the sleeve 20). Conversely, when the side of the movable clamping block 23 disengages from the measuring scale 22, the measuring scale 22 regains its degree of freedom and can make longitudinal relative movements within the sleeve 20. After adjusting to the appropriate position, it can be clamped again using the movable clamping block 23.
